Catalyst Robotics, Co-Founder

April 2021 - Current

We are building autonomous mobile health clinics that bring self-service healthcare screenings directly to patients. At Catalyst, I primarily create systems and develop software for two projects - (1) autonomous perception and navigation and (2) non-invasive face scan to check pulse, body temperature, and other health metrics.
